Susie Wolff launches initiative for women

– Former Williams test driver Susie Wolff has announced the launch of an initiative called 'Dare To Be Different', with the aim of increasing female involvement in motorsport.Wolff, who participated in several practice sessions for Williams before announcing her retirement last November, launched Dare To Be Different on Thursday, alongside the UK's Motor Sport Association.The scheme's slogan says it is "committed to inspiring, connecting, showcasing and developing talent in male-dominated environments and professions.""I believe we are defined by our strengths and characteristics in life, not gender," said Wolff."I found my passion early in life and had a...
